Improving dietary and physical activity behaviours in women in midlife (aged 40 - 65 years) Nutritional, Metabolic, Endocrine

Inclusion criteria
Inclusion criteria: 1. Women who are between ages 40 – 65 years 2. Women who are UK residents 3. Ability to converse in English
Exclusion criteria
Exclusion criteria: 1. Treatment for a serious mental health condition 2. Pregnancy, or trying to get pregnant 3. Serious life-threatening illness (i.e., cancer, heart failure) 4. Currently enrolled in another lifestyle study 5. Inability to converse in English 6. Unable to wear a fitness tracker on the wrist for 21 consecutive days, for a minimum of 8 hours/day 7. Unable to refrain from wearing any other fitness trackers or lifestyle apps (specifically for diet and physical activity), for the duration of the study 8. Unable to engage in the study for 21 consecutive days without the need to travel internationally.

| The following feasibility aspects of the study are measured using: 1. Recruitment rate: the number of participants who are recruited, represented as a percentage of the number of participants who show interest, at baseline 2. Attrition rate: the percentage of participants who withdraw after signing Informed Consent at 3 weeks. 3. Retention rate: the percentage of participants who complete all programme components and evaluation measurements at 3 weeks 4. Compliance rates: represented by: 4.1. Percentage of participants who fully comply with wearing the provided accelerometer measured using a recorded minimum of 8-hrs of daily Garmin data at 3 weeks 4.2. Percentage of participants who record daily physical activity and sleep, measured using recorded 24-hr daily Garmin data at 3 weeks 4.3. Percentage of participants who complete daily mEMA surveys (each prompt even if not all subsections) at 3 weeks 4.4. Percentage of participants who review mEMA education content at 3 weeks 4.5. Percentage of participants who complete the study surveys at 1 week, and at 3 weeks 4.6. Percentage of patients who complete the evaluation (exit) questionnaire at 3 weeks 5. Response rate: represented by 5.1. The percentage of daily completed surveys out of the total number of surveys administered to the participant over the entire study period. Responses will be considered complete if the participants answer every question on the sub-surveys 5.2. The amount of time spent reading the mEMA education content on healthy eating, physical activity, and menopause 5.3. Wearing the Garmin fitness tracker for at least 8-hrs daily for 3 weeks The mean response rate for the sample will be computed as the arithmetic mean of the participant’s individual response rates. 6. Acceptability of the study to all participants measured using the evaluation (exit) questionnaire (based on TFA), including measured items and quotes from the participants, immediately after completing their 21-day programme | — |

| 1. Number of daily steps walked, measured using accelerometer at baseline (a 7-day average), and daily for 14 days during the intervention period. 2. Minutes of moderate-intensity activity measured using an accelerometer at baseline (a 7-day average), and daily for 14 days during the intervention period. A pre-study baseline and post-study questionnaire (IPAQ-SF) will also capture this self-reported data. 3. Sleep length and quality (reduced awake time) measured using an accelerometer at baseline (a 7-day average), and daily for 14 days during the intervention period. A pre-study baseline and post-study questionnaire (PSQI) will also capture this self-reported data. 4. Hydration measured daily using mEMA surveys for 14 days. A pre-study baseline questionnaire and post-study questionnaire (SFFFQ) will also capture this self-reported data. 5. Caffeinated beverage intake measured daily using mEMA surveys for 14 days. A pre-study baseline questionnaire and post-study questionnaire (SFFFQ) will also capture this self-reported data. 6. Alcoholic beverage consumption measured daily using mEMA surveys for 14 days. A pre-study baseline questionnaire and post-study questionnaire (SFFFQ) will also capture this self-reported data. 7. Consumption of portions of fruit and vegetables measured daily using mEMA surveys for 14 days. A pre-study baseline questionnaire and post-study questionnaire (SFFFQ) will also capture this self-reported data. 8. Number of skipped meals measured daily using mEMA surveys for 14 days. A pre-study baseline questionnaire and post-study questionnaire (SFFFQ) will also capture this self-reported data. 9. Number of snacks consumed measured daily using mEMA surveys for 14 days. A pre-study baseline questionnaire and post-study questionnaire (SFFFQ) will also capture this self-reported data. 10.
